Is 297 707 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 297 707 is about 545.625.

Thus, the square root of 297 707 is not an integer, and therefore 297 707 is not a square number.

Anyway, 297 707 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 297 707?

The square of a number (here 297 707) is the result of the product of this number (297 707) by itself (i.e., 297 707 × 297 707); the square of 297 707 is sometimes called "raising 297 707 to the power 2", or "297 707 squared".

The square of 297 707 is 88 629 457 849 because 297 707 × 297 707 = 297 7072 = 88 629 457 849.

As a consequence, 297 707 is the square root of 88 629 457 849.
